Output e08b5dfde080420b7f8a2befc1eee6cf0afbd8a77787797c6d771facf0d7becd:15

value
2306637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39ca1369f1f47a6f16e1dc6b46f0ea623ac1242c OP_EQUAL
address
36xaWxF4mAe4MyjkDtSzPs9wz1TjZmmx89
transaction
e08b5dfde080420b7f8a2befc1eee6cf0afbd8a77787797c6d771facf0d7becd
confirmations
319294
spent
true